AgCu12SbAs4S13
AgCu12SbAs4S13 is a complex inorganic compound. Its chemical formula indicates the presence of silver (Ag), copper (Cu), antimony (Sb), arsenic (As), and sulfur (S) in a specific stoichiometric ratio. This compound belongs to the sulfosalt mineral group, which are characterized by structures containing thioanionic groups. The precise crystal structure and properties of AgCu12SbAs4S13 can vary depending on synthesis conditions. It is not a commonly found or extensively studied mineral. Research into similar complex sulfosalts often focuses on their potential for unique electronic or optical properties due to the presence of multiple metal cations and chalcogen elements. The study of such compounds contributes to understanding the diverse chemical bonding and structural arrangements possible within inorganic materials.
